Uber Eats has arrived in Kamloops

It’s been a few weeks since Uber finally launched in Kamloops and now the company’s food delivery service has arrived as well.

Uber Eats announced today that it’s now available in six more British Columbian cities, which includes the River City.

“These days, supporting your favourite restaurants isn’t always easy,” said Lola Kassim, general manager of Uber Eats Canada.

“We are committed to working with the city’s restaurant scene to bring you the best Kamloops has to offer at the touch of a button.”

The app is launching with more than 30 local spots to choose from and will surely expand that selection over the coming weeks and months.

For now, options like Hoja Mongolian Grill Restaurant, McCracken Station Pub, Papa John's and Carlos O'Bryan's Neighbourhood Pub are all available through Uber Eats.

"We have all suffered through this pandemic and Uber Eats provides all of us another avenue to reach customers and let them know we are still here and available," said Chris Pooli, operations manager at Carlos O'Bryan's.

"The extra revenue gained with Uber Eats will be very helpful in an industry that is really struggling to stay afloat right now."

“Delivery platforms can offer a new revenue stream for local restaurants, providing access to a network of delivery people and an audience of new customers,” explains a press release.

“With Uber Eats, restaurants can choose between flexible options like 0% pick-up, 7.5% for online ordering and 15% for restaurants who use their own delivery staff in addition to our full-service option.”

The rapidly-expanding Uber Eats is now available in more than 120 Canadian cities.
